With tens of thousands of internally displaced people arriving daily, their mobile clinics, emergency aid, and central kitchens are under immense pressure and urgently need support.Voice of Darfur Women (VODW): Food, Shelter, and Trauma Response training for Darfur’s uprooted.At Tulum Camp, a newly established refugee camp near the Chad border, VODW was among the first organizations to aid those fleeing violence from Zamzam Camp and Al-Fasher. Recognizing the urgent needs of displaced families, VODW distributed food, essential supplies, and rugs to help them settle under challenging conditions. Beyond material support, VODW also conducted two critical workshops on assisting injured individuals, equipping refugees with basic first aid knowledge to care for wounded community members. As one of the first responders in this camp, VODW’s presence has been vital in providing both immediate relief and long-term resilience-building for those affected by the crisis.Barana Hanabneiho Youth Organisation (BHO) – Food Packages in SudanBHO, registered with the Humanitarian Aid Commission, is running an emergency campaign to ease the suffering of displaced citizens by supplying food, water, and warm clothing.
